Summary

YouTubers Dan and Tyler play a game of "Never Have I Ever: YouTube Stalker Edition." They take turns answering questions about their experiences with other YouTubers, sharing stories about stalking, rejection, and awkward encounters. The game gets increasingly personal and humorous, with the two friends joking about their own creepiness and YouTube trashiness. The video ends with a forfeit, where the loser is shocked with a device brought by Tyler, leading to a chaotic and hilarious conclusion.
